### Step 4 — Migrate the feed validator

For review: Castcheck, our podcast feed validator, moves from the shared worker pool to its own service in this step. Outbound fetches to feed URLs are now routed through the egress proxy, with redirects capped and private-range addresses blocked at the resolver. Response bodies are size-limited before parsing, and the XML parser runs with external entities disabled. The deployed service applies the configuration values listed below.

config for tajof-kawep:
[aldius]
port = 3000
region = lower-2
host = aldius.plorvasoft.example
team = eliius
timeout_ms = 750
retries = 6

Subject: Per-tenant rate quotas landing in Driftgate 4.2

Hey plugin folks — heads up that Driftgate now enforces per-tenant rate quotas instead of the old global bucket. If your plugin hammers the sync endpoint, expect 429s sooner. Defaults are generous, but test against staging this week. The staging build to target is identified below.

build token for kagaf-hahof: htk14_9d3d4d26d7d8de

Facilities Ticket — Vantorre Logistics, Building C

Request: temporary after-hours access to the server room for the night shift during the cooling-unit replacement by Halden Engineering. Access is approved between 22:00 and 06:00 only. Sign the log sheet mounted by the door on every entry and exit, and confirm the inner cage is latched before leaving. The main badge reader is disabled during the works, so the mechanical keypad is in use. The keypad code for the duration of the works is as follows.

staff pass of kawip-hawef = bdg-QLP-2

Subject: Partner SFTP drop — new owner

Hi,

As you review the pending changes to the Harborline ingest scripts, note that ownership of the partner SFTP drop is changing at the end of the month. This includes key rotation, the nightly pull job, and the quarantine folder for malformed files. Review comments on the retry logic should still go through the normal PR flow, but questions about drop-folder conventions or partner onboarding now go to the new owner. The incoming owner is listed below.

signatory, tagaf-bahaf: Praael Fenmir Rusok